Electrostatic painting with powder coating is a popular method for applying a durable, high-quality finish to metal objects. It uses an electrical charge to ensure an even coating of powdered paint on a surface, which is then baked to cure. Here’s a step-by-step guide on how to do powder coating with electrostatic painting:

### **Materials and Equipment Needed**
1. **Powder coating gun**: Specifically designed for electrostatic application.
2. **Powder coating powder**: The paint in a fine powder form.
3. **Compressed air system**: To help propel the powder.
4. **Grounding equipment**: Ensures safety and effectiveness.
5. **Oven**: For curing, often specialized for powder coating (industrial ovens work best).
6. **Cleaning supplies**: Degreasers, detergents, and sandblasters for surface preparation.
7. **Personal protective equipment (PPE)**: Gloves, goggles, and respirators.

### **Step-by-Step Process**

#### 1. **Surface Preparation**
– **Clean the Surface**: The object must be free of dirt, grease, oil, and other contaminants. This can be done using degreasers, detergents, or solvents.
– **Blast the Surface**: Use abrasive blasting (e.g., sandblasting) to remove rust, old paint, and to create a rough texture for better adhesion.
– **Rinse and Dry**: Ensure the object is completely dry before moving on to the next step.

#### 2. **Ground the Object**
– Proper grounding is essential to attract the powder to the object. Attach a grounding clip from the powder coating system to the object you’re painting. This ensures the object becomes negatively charged.

#### 3. **Apply the Powder**
– **Load the Powder Coating Gun**: Fill the gun with the powder coating material.
– **Set the Gun’s Air Pressure**: Adjust the air pressure according to the type of powder you’re using.
– **Apply the Powder**: Hold the gun about 6-8 inches from the surface. As you pull the trigger, an electrostatic charge is applied to the powder, causing it to be attracted to the grounded object. Move the gun smoothly to ensure an even coat.

#### 4. **Curing the Powder**
– Once the powder is evenly applied, the object is placed into an oven.
– **Bake at the Required Temperature**: Most powder coatings cure at around 350-400°F (177-204°C) for 10-20 minutes. Follow the powder manufacturer’s instructions for specific curing times and temperatures.
– **Monitor the Curing Process**: The heat causes the powder to melt and flow, forming a smooth, durable coating.

#### 5. **Cooling and Inspection**
– After baking, allow the object to cool down naturally.
– Inspect the finish for any imperfections. The coating should be smooth and uniform, with no bubbles, cracks, or runs.

### **Tips for Success**
– **Ensure Proper Grounding**: Poor grounding can result in uneven coating or powder loss.
– **Maintain a Clean Environment**: Keep the workspace dust-free to avoid particles sticking to the coating.
– **Practice Consistent Gun Movement**: For an even coat, maintain consistent speed and distance from the object.
– **Proper Oven Settings**: Ensure the oven maintains a uniform temperature for consistent curing.

By following these steps, you should be able to achieve a professional-quality powder coat finish.
